The Iowa Board of Regents hires the president of the University of Iowa and the university president reports to the board. The 22nd and current president of the University of Iowa is Barbara J. Wilson, who has served since July 15, 2021.
== Undergraduate admissions ==
The 2022 annual ranking of U.S. News & World Report categorizes UIowa as "more selective." For the Class of 2025 (enrolled fall 2021), UIowa received 22,434 applications and accepted 19,340 (86.2%). Of those accepted, 4,521 enrolled, a yield rate (the percentage of accepted students who choose to attend the university) of 23.4%. UIowa's freshman retention rate is 88%, with 73.7% going on to graduate within six years.
